A 10 L flask containing 10.8 g of N₂O₅ is heated to 373 K, which leads to its decomposition according to the equation 2 N₂O₅(g) → 4 NO₂(g) + O₂(g). If the final pressure in the flask is 0.5 atm, then the partial pressure of O₂(g) in atm is __. [Given R = 0.0821 L atm K⁻¹ mol⁻¹]
Numerical answer
View written solutionFree

Correct answer: 0.06, 0.07
